Yb:Er:glass is commonly Utilized in distance measurements, environmental monitoring, and defense apps on account of its significant get. Tm:YAG is suited for higher-power applications like wind velocity measurements and atmospheric studies.
Though Yb:Er:glass provides higher optical gain and a watch-safe emission wavelength, Tm:YAG is a lot more fitted to higher-electrical power apps. Another possible hazard originates from lasers meant to be eye-safe beneath specific running ailments. Modifications to these ailments, such as growing the laser power or modifying the beam’s target, can change the laser’s output into non-eye-safe areas.
Eye Safe Laser Crystal Module The problems threshold for human eye is high when a laser by using a wavelength greater than one.4 um, mainly because when it is irradiated for the human eye, the vast majority of its light intensity is absorbed from the vitreous entire body, so It's not click here at all uncomplicated to wreck the retina at a specific energy.( Using the 1.57um laser as an example, in accordance with the US countrywide protection criteria, its safe exposure to human eye is 400 thousand periods that of your one.06um Nd:YAG laser at present utilized.
